Vue Draggable 是一個用于 Vue.js 的可拖拽列表組件。它允許用戶通過鼠標或觸摸手勢來重排一個列表或者改變其內容順序。該組件基于 SortableJS 構建,帶有高度的可定制化和擴展性。
要使用 Vue Draggable,必需先安裝 SortableJS。
npm install sortablejs
接下來,就可以在 Vue 組件中使用 Vue Draggable 了。將它導入到一個 Vue 組件中,定義一個列表和一個回調函數,并將它們傳入組件。假設列表的數據是從父組件中傳遞的,那么組件將會像這樣:
{{ item.name }}
對于以上代碼中的實例,如果需要設置可拖拽列表的一些選項,可以通過 props 對象傳遞相應的設置項。例如,可以通過設置group
來定義不同的列表組:
{{ item.name }}
在 Vue Draggable 中支持許多其他的設置項,包括排序、排序規則、過濾、Draggable 元素的 CSS 類等等。它是一個非常靈活的可拖拽列表組件,能夠滿足各種需求。
總之,Vue Draggable 是一個用于 Vue.js 的十分強大且靈活的可拖拽列表組件。它能夠輕松地為頁面提供可拖拽、重排和內容更新的功能。不僅如此,對于項目有不同的需求,Vue Draggable 還有更多的自定義選項可供使用。
上一篇python 繼續進行
下一篇c 發送json數據格式